Hemal Ranasinghe Released on Bail

Actor Hemal Ranasinghe has been released on a surety of Ra 100,000 by the Mount Lavinia Magistrate’s Court.

Earlier today (3), he was arrested for allededly asaulting a person when he arrived in Wellawatte police station to provide a statement.

Ranasinghe who attended a film launch ceremony held on 8 January 2026 at the Havelock City Mall in Wellawatte has been arrested following a complaint alleging that he assaulted an advertising creative who was also present at the event.

According to the complaint, the alleged assault took place at the conclusion of the ceremony. Acting on the complaint, the Wellawatte Police Station arrested the suspect on 3 February 2026.

Police said the suspect had been informed on several occasions to appear before the police but had failed to do so. He was taken into custody when he eventually appeared at the police station through an attorney on 3 February.

The Wellawatte Police have submitted CCTV footage related to the incident to the Mount Lavinia Magistrate’s Court and reported the relevant facts to court.
